European vs. American Roulette: Which is Better?

Roulette is one of the most iconic and visually thrilling games available on any casino floor.

IMG_1615-1.jpg

The variation you decide to play has a massive impact on your mathematical chances of walking away a winner.

The Green Zero: The House’s Secret Weapon

The European roulette wheel features 37 slots in total: numbers 1 through 36, plus a single green zero.

That extra double zero on the American wheel might look harmless, but it drastically increases the operator’s profit margin.

  • The single zero is the only reason the casino makes a profit on Red/Black or Odd/Even wagers
  • Adding a second zero effectively doubles the speed at which you will statistically lose your bankroll
  • The visual layout of the numbers on the wheel itself is also completely different between the two versions

Advanced European Roulette Rules

If you can find a French roulette table, you will encounter the best possible odds for this specific game.

The ‘En Prison’ rule allows your even-money bet to remain ‘in prison’ for the next spin if a zero hits, giving you a second chance.

Game Type Special Rules? House Edge (Even-Money Bets)
Standard European No 2.70%
French (La Partage) Yes (Half-back on Zero) 1.35%

By simply choosing the European wheel, you instantly double your expected mathematical longevity at the casino.
